Assembly Elections 2019 LIVE Updates: Prime Minister Narendra Modi will today address rallies in three districts of Maharashtra, including Akola, Partur, and Panvel. His campaign rallies come a day after the BJP released its manifesto for the state. In the manifesto, the party has proposed the names of Mahatma Phule, Savitribai Phule and Veer Savarkar for the Bharat Ratna among promises of one crore jobs and better healthcare facilities.

The PMC Bank scam also found a mention during the manifesto release as CM Devendra Fandavis said, "We will request the Centre to help depositors get their money back. I will personally be following up on this so that all the money of the PMC depositors is returned."

Erstwhile Congress leader and party's former Haryana president Ashok Tanwar on Wednesday said he will support Dushyant Chautala-led Jananayak Janta Party. Tanwar grabbed headlines earlier this month after he protested outside Congress president Sonia Gandhi's residence here over alleged irregularities in ticket distribution. Later, he resigned from the party. "I left Congress with pain and now my workers want to support Dushyant so I am doing so," he said at a press conference where Chautala was also present.

Shiv Sena MP Attacked in Rally | Shiv Sena MP Omraje Nimbalkar was injured after man attacked him with a knife in Maharashtra's Osmanabad. The man came close to Nimbalkar, on the pretext of shaking hands with him. "While greeting the MP, the man attacked him with a knife and immediately fled. Nimbalkar got hurt on his hand but escaped a major injury because of his wrist watch," he said. His father Pawanraje Nimbalkar was shot dead in his car on June 3, 2006.
